Part Number
AK9232NK
Category
Data Acquisition - Analog to Digital Converters (ADC)
Manufacturer
Asahi Kasei Microdevices/AKM
Description
IC ADC 18BIT SAR 24QFN
Package
Jinftry-Reel®
Series
-
Features
Internal Oscillator
Operating Temperature
-40°C ~ 105°C
Mounting Type
Surface Mount
Package / Case
24-WFQFN Exposed Pad
Supplier Device Package
24-QFN (4x4)
Reference Type
External, Internal
Sampling Rate (Per Second)
1.1M
Data Interface
-
Number of Bits
18
Voltage - Supply, Analog
1.7V ~ 2V
Voltage - Supply, Digital
1.7V ~ 2V
Number of Inputs
2
Input Type
Differential
Configuration
ADC
Ratio - S/H:ADC
0:1
Number of A/D Converters
2
Architecture
SAR
